Guitar Meets Science has shared a new mini-documentary about longtime HardRadio friends BADLANDS. "This week, we dig into the fiery rise and shocking fall of Badlands—the supergroup that had everything going for it: Jake E. Lee, fresh off his tenure with Ozzy Osbourne, powerhouse vocalist Ray Gillen, bassist Greg Chaisson, and former Black Sabbath drummer Eric Singer. Formed in the late '80s, Badlands aimed to bring blues-based hard rock back to the forefront, rejecting the synth-heavy direction of glam. With their debut album earning critical acclaim, they seemed destined for greatness. But behind the scenes, personal battles, label frustrations, and industry betrayals tore the band apart. We'll explore how Badlands defied the era's trends, how Ray Gillen's health and controversies derailed everything, and why this band remains one of the greatest 'what could have been' stories in rock history."
